In contrast, the highest incidences of infection were associated with Brucella species (641 cases per 100,000 laboratory technologists, compared with 0.08 cases per 100,000 persons in the general population) and Neisseria meningitidis (25.3 cases per 100,000 laboratory technologists, compared with 0.62 cases per 100,000 persons in the general population). Sixteen cases of probable laboratory-acquired meningococcal disease were identified, including 6 cases in the United States. The largest survey of infections was reported in 1976 by Pike [3], who found that 4079 laboratory-acquired infections were due to 159 agents, although 10 agents accounted for >50% of the cases (table 1) [3, 4].
